You might be unaware of the fact that once New Zealand was a part of Australia. However, in 1901, as Australia federated, it offered New Zealand to become one of its state, but New Zealand refused it and preferred staying independent.
New Zealand is famous for the bird known as kiwi. Kiwi is a beautiful bird that belongs to New Zealand and usually used for the people that belong to this country. New Zealand is among the countries that covered to way to democracy in a quick way. In 1893, it was among the fewer countries where there was equal right for both the men and women in New Zealand to vote.
New Zealand was first discovered by Europeans in 1642; however they could not stay over there. In 1769 an English captain visited the land again and drew a map of the land for the first time. New Zealand officially belongs to Queen Elizabeth II and she is represented by a governor.

According to “Quality of Living Survey” which was conducted by Mercer Consultings world’s top 10 places for living were ranked .The rankings are based on point index established by Mercer Consultings, Cities are compared with New York as the base city with an index score of 100.
The survey also highlights those cities with the highest personal safety ranking based on internal stability, crime, effectiveness of law enforcement, and relationships with other countries.
Here are the world’s top ten places to live:
1 – Vienna, Austria
Vienna is ranked number one in 2009 survey while it was on second number in 2008. Total population of the city is 1,664,146 and country’s total population is 8,210,281. The average age of people or life expectancy is 79.5 and GDP is $325 billion.
2 – Zurich, Switzerland
In 2008 Zurich was on top but this drop to second place. The population of city is 1,307,567 and country’s total population is 7,604,467. GDP is 309.9 billion and life expectancy is 80 to 85.
